Silver Mercury: A Detailed Overview

Mercury in its liquid state is a fascinating substance, often referred to as "silver mercury" due to its peculiar appearance. This substance presents numerous intriguing properties , including its substantial density, peculiar surface tension, and noticeable ability to generate globular droplets. Its past usage in various applications, from thermometers to industrial equipment, has diminished with the invention of safer replacements, but understanding its fundamental nature remains important for scientific purposes and appreciating its place in the periodic table .
